Viraj Puri - Who says a 13 year old can't change the world?!

As we all know, social media is a common vessel for modern day bullying. So much so that 'Cyber Bullying' is something that has touched all of us in some way.  We have all seen those extreme comments on an Instagram or Twitter post. Some people's reactions are to fight back. Others are to stay quiet and not get involved. Others sit back and wonder how someone could be so mean and hurtful without even knowing who they are insulting nor their audience. Well, a young man by the name of Viraj Puri has taken a very unique approach to cyber bullying. 
Check out this BBC exclusive video that depicts the basic idea behind Viraj's anti-bullying approach. We find this analytic approach to be profound for such a young mind! Not convinced? Check out his blog - Bullyvention. This blog exhibits his work with Capital Hill to create intriguing heat maps based on formulas that categorize social media conversations with bullying keywords and tones.
